Xiaojing Gong is a scholar working on Biomedical Engineering, Radiology, Nuclear Medicine and Imaging and Mechanics of Materials. According to data from OpenAlex, Xiaojing Gong has authored 66 papers receiving a total of 1.6k indexed citations (citations by other indexed papers that have themselves been cited), including 51 papers in Biomedical Engineering, 17 papers in Radiology, Nuclear Medicine and Imaging and 17 papers in Mechanics of Materials. Recurrent topics in Xiaojing Gong’s work include Photoacoustic and Ultrasonic Imaging (43 papers), Nanoplatforms for cancer theranostics (18 papers) and Thermography and Photoacoustic Techniques (17 papers). Xiaojing Gong is often cited by papers focused on Photoacoustic and Ultrasonic Imaging (43 papers), Nanoplatforms for cancer theranostics (18 papers) and Thermography and Photoacoustic Techniques (17 papers). Xiaojing Gong collaborates with scholars based in China, Hong Kong and United States. Xiaojing Gong's co-authors include Liang Song, Chengbo Liu, Riqiang Lin, Jingqin Chen, Zonghai Sheng, Rongqin Zheng, Hairong Zheng, William Kongto Hau, Ningbo Chen and Huangxuan Zhao and has published in prestigious journals such as Physical Review Letters, ACS Nano and PLoS ONE.
